symphony

/ˈsɪm.fə.ni/
B1 · Intermediate★★★☆☆
noun

Simple Meaning

a long piece of music written for a large group of musicians called an orchestra.

Examples in Conversation

We went to hear a beautiful symphony at the concert hall last night.

Beethoven's Fifth Symphony is one of the most famous pieces of music ever written.

Full Definition

An extended piece of music of sophisticated structure, usually for orchestra.
